Everyonce in awhile I (N.) really want one of these which is quite impressive since I don’t really like vegetables. Normally when I eat them they must be chopped into microscopic pieces that I can’t avoid eating. I’m getting better…
Since it’s still winter we didn’t have lettuce but what we did have was leftover local beansprouts from our lo mein recipe and I figured they would make a good substitute. Now J. and I were both skeptical in fact he opted out entirely (bastard!) but it turned out really good and I am now a sprout fan. We used homemade bread and toasted it, put a layer of spicy brown mustard (the sprouts were a great balance to the spiciness), tomato slices, and a slice of bacon and it was fantabulous. I had apples on the side, not local but they are organic, and it made a great dinner.
